Multiple Sets of Ashes:
This pendant can be made with multiple sets of ashes which can all produce differently colored settings but this is not guaranteed. No color is added to the ashes during the setting process to create a specific color or hue. If this pendant is made with only one set of ashes, the same color will be produced across all of the settings. Each piece is set in our office, located in Southern California. Only a very small amount of ashes is used in the setting process; the exact amount needed depends on the size and depth of the piece's setting, but for simplicity's sake, a teaspoon of ashes will suffice for most orders. The setting process solidifies the ashes and brings out their natural color, which may differ from those in the piece photographed.
